Job DescriptionElectromechanical TechnicianJob Description
Responsible for building both new and existing products, including custom assemblies for clients. This role involves constructing up to five subassemblies weekly, primarily focusing on mechanical assembly tasks. The Technician will follow work instructions and blueprints, collaborating with the engineering team to ensure precise and efficient assembly processes.
Responsibilities
- Assemble components and troubleshoot mechanical systems such as gears, gearboxes, motors, pumps, and other related systems using hand and power tools.
- Perform precision soldering on electronic components on Printed Circuit Boards (PCBs) in compliance with IPC-J-STD-001 soldering standards.
- Conduct various assembly operations, including assembling cables and mechanical subsystems of medium to high complexity.
- Perform in-process inspections to ensure quality and adherence to design specifications.
- Connect and test units using test equipment such as power supplies and multi-meters, measuring voltage, amps, wattage, and frequency.
- Evaluate and repair units that do not meet specifications, documenting test data and comparing results with standards.
Essential Skills
- Proficient in mechanical assembly, including using calipers, torque wrenches, micrometers, and other small hand tools.
- Experience in soldering through-hole and surface mount components.
- Ability to troubleshoot mechanical issues independently before consulting engineers.
- Skilled in electrical wiring and electronic assembly.
Additional Skills & Qualifications
- Experience with digital multimeters, insulation resistance meters, soldering skills, and oscilloscopes.
- Capability to verify drawings, identify inaccuracies, and communicate findings effectively.
- Common reasoning ability to resolve problems independently.
